1. Cracking and Damage
One of the most common issues with Rev9 turbo manifolds is cracking. This can occur due to the high temperatures generated during operation, especially if the manifold is made from lower quality materials. Cracks can lead to exhaust leaks, reduced performance, and even engine damage.
Solution
To prevent cracking, consider the following:
- Invest in a high-quality manifold made from durable materials like stainless steel.
- Ensure proper installation with adequate support to minimize stress on the manifold.
- Regularly inspect the manifold for signs of wear or damage.
2. Boost Leaks
Boost leaks can significantly impact the performance of your turbocharged engine. They often occur at the connections between the manifold and the turbo or at the wastegate. These leaks can cause a drop in boost pressure, leading to a loss of power.
Solution
To fix boost leaks, follow these steps:
- Use a boost leak tester to identify the source of the leak.
- Check all connections and gaskets for wear and replace as necessary.
- Ensure that clamps are tightened properly to secure the connections.
3. Improper Fitment
Improper fitment is another common issue that can arise with Rev9 turbo manifolds. This can lead to misalignment with the turbo, causing stress on the components and potential failures.
Solution
To ensure proper fitment:
- Double-check compatibility with your specific vehicle model before purchasing.
- Consult installation guides or professional mechanics for assistance.
- Use adjustable mounts or spacers if necessary to achieve the correct alignment.
4. Heat Soak
Heat soak can be a significant issue for turbo manifolds, especially in high-performance applications. When the manifold absorbs excessive heat, it can lead to decreased performance and increased turbo lag.
Solution
To combat heat soak:
- Consider heat wrapping the manifold to reduce heat absorption.
- Install heat shields or blankets to protect the manifold from engine heat.
- Ensure proper airflow around the manifold to dissipate heat effectively.
5. Exhaust Gas Temperature (EGT) Issues
High EGTs can indicate problems with the turbo manifold or the overall tuning of the engine. Excessive temperatures can lead to component failure and reduced engine lifespan.
Solution
To monitor and manage EGTs:
- Install an EGT gauge to keep track of exhaust temperatures during operation.
- Ensure that your engine is properly tuned for the turbo setup.
- Consider upgrading to a larger turbo or intercooler to improve efficiency and reduce EGTs.
